lithium 1 s 2 2 s 1 1 valence electron

beryllium 1 s 2 2 s 2 2 valence electrons

nitrogen 1 s 2 2 s 2 2 p 3 5 valence electrons

neon 1 s 2 2 s 2 2 p 6 8 valence electrons
